import { type VariantProps } from "tailwind-variants"; import type { Classes } from "../theme/themeUtils"; export declare const dropdown: import("tailwind-variants").TVReturnType<{} | {} | {}, undefined, "mt-2 divide-y divide-gray-300 dark:divide-gray-500 overflow-hidden rounded-lg bg-white shadow-sm dark:bg-gray-700", {} | {}, undefined, import("tailwind-variants").TVReturnType>; export declare const dropdownDivider: import("tailwind-variants").TVReturnType<{} | {} | {}, undefined, "my-1 h-px bg-gray-100 dark:bg-gray-500", {} | {}, undefined, import("tailwind-variants").TVReturnType>; export declare const dropdownHeader: import("tailwind-variants").TVReturnType<{} | {} | {}, undefined, "px-4 py-3 text-sm text-gray-900 dark:text-white", {} | {}, undefined, import("tailwind-variants").TVReturnType>; export type DropdownItemVariants = VariantProps & Classes; export declare const dropdownItem: import("tailwind-variants").TVReturnType<{ [key: string]: { [key: string]: import("tailwind-merge").ClassNameValue | { base?: import("tailwind-merge").ClassNameValue; li?: import("tailwind-merge").ClassNameValue; active?: import("tailwind-merge").ClassNameValue; }; }; } | { [x: string]: { [x: string]: import("tailwind-merge").ClassNameValue | { base?: import("tailwind-merge").ClassNameValue; li?: import("tailwind-merge").ClassNameValue; active?: import("tailwind-merge").ClassNameValue; }; }; } | {}, { base: string; active: string; li: string; }, undefined, { [key: string]: { [key: string]: import("tailwind-merge").ClassNameValue | { base?: import("tailwind-merge").ClassNameValue; li?: import("tailwind-merge").ClassNameValue; active?: import("tailwind-merge").ClassNameValue; }; }; } | {}, { base: string; active: string; li: string; }, import("tailwind-variants").TVReturnType>; export declare const dropdownGroup: import("tailwind-variants").TVReturnType<{} | {} | {}, undefined, "py-2 text-sm text-gray-700 dark:text-gray-200", {} | {}, undefined, import("tailwind-variants").TVReturnType>;